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

deplacer des feuilles

  • Initiateur de la discussion Initiateur de la discussion MacMac
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

MacMac

XLDnaute Occasionnel
bonjour le forum ,

j'avais recuper un formulaire pour imprimer des feuilles exelente je dirai meme et je tiens a remercier la personne qui la creer car exelent bouleau 🙂 🙂 🙂
que j'ai ajouter a mon application

je voudrai savoir si il est possible de rajouter un bouton pour deplacer des feuille de mon classeur sur un autre fichier que je nomerai archive pour liberai mon application principal qui me sert de base pour remplir un rapport journalier
via un formulaire
tout en sachant que je diserai que mon fichier archive s'ouvrirai en meme temp que mon application principal pour qu'il soit en relation bon sa je pense le voir apres car chaque etape se font au fur et a mesur ne pas tout melange
le but principal serai de deplacer les feuille de mon classeur sur l'autre classeur
en sachant que les deux applications serai dans le meme endroit

le but est aleger mon applications principal

un grand merci pour l'aide que je recoit de se forum

@+ MacMac
 

Pièces jointes

Re : deplacer des feuilles

Bonjour MacMac

Si ca peut t aider, ci-dessous ligne de code permettant de déplacer la Feuil1 du classeur1 vers le classeur2 :

Attention les 2 classeurs doivent être enregistrés, sinon enlèves les extensions ".xls".


Code:
Workbooks("Classeur1.xls").Sheets("Feuil1").Move _
    after:=Workbooks("Classeur2.xls").Sheets(Workbooks("Classeur2.xls").Sheets.Count)

Bon après midi
@+
 
Re : deplacer des feuilles

Bonjour ,Pierrot93

Voila je viens essayer de mettre le code est cela ne fonctionne pas
je pense que l'erreur vient de moi je ne doit savoir ou placer ce code
j'ai essayer dans mon application si dessus en la corrigant par rapport a moi
mais sans succes j'ai meme suprimer comme tu le dit la parti XLS mais bon je suis sur que l'on vas trouver une solution mon but principal etant de creer un bouton sur mon formulaire si dessus de slectionner les feuille et quelle se deplace en cliquant sur le bouton un peu comme le bouton supprimer les feuilles

deja un grand merci d'essayer de m'aider au mieux dans mon application


MacMac
 
Re : deplacer des feuilles

Re MacMac,

j'ai mis le code du bouton dans la feuille 1 (click droit sur le nom de longlet => visualiser le code)

Enregistre un classeur avec le nom "Classeur2.xls", les 2 classeurs doivent être ouverts.

Click sur le bouton et ta feuille 2 est déplacée.

Chez moi ca marche très bien.

bon après midi
@+
 

Pièces jointes

Re : deplacer des feuilles

Re Pierrot93,

Je tien a te remercier pour ton code et ton explication je serne mieux la
mais le hic s'est que j'aurai aimer l'inserer dans mon formulaire de facon que je selectionne un dixaine de feuille qui vont se deplacer car je t'explique s'est arriver un moment il y aura beaucoup de feuille dans mon application une par jour
donc voila mon souci le but s'est que je deplace un mois complet

merci encor de ton aide

MacMac @+
 
Re : deplacer des feuilles

Re MacMac

tu dois pouvoir te servir de ce code en l'adaptant et l'insérant dans une boucle "For Each" avec un test sur le nom des feuilles (le nom du mois peut être). Il ny a pas de raison que cela ne marche pas.

bon courage et bonne fin d'après midi
@+
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Réponses
4
Affichages
768
E
Réponses
4
Affichages
1 K
ecluse105
E
W
Réponses
4
Affichages
3 K
WhatIsVBA
W
M
Réponses
5
Affichages
4 K
MagaliRC
M
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…